<p style="text-align:justify;">Barack Obama ran a very successful campaign for the Presidency (obviously!), part of that campaign was his utilisation of a whole host of modern communication techniques.  This ranged from having his own Flickr account giving a behind the scenes look to his campaign, to the effective use of YouTube &#8211; on election day alone the Obama campaign uploaded 14 videos!  They uploaded more than 1,800 over the whole campaign.  Of course the most famous use of modern technology by the Obama campaign was the way the VP pick was announced &#8211; by text message.</p>
<p style="text-align:justify;">But it wasn&#8217;t just the Campaign&#8217;s use of these technologies that marked out this campaign against the ones gone before, supporters and supporting organisations have also used them to great impact.  Some of the biggest Youtube successes during the last year have been related to either Obama and McCain.  But it was mainly Obama that benefited from this support.  Perhaps the most famous YouTube video was by Will.i.am from the Black Eyed Peas.  His &#8220;Yes We Can&#8221; video has been viewed more than 13 million times.  His new video &#8220;It&#8217;s a New Day&#8221; (below) looks set to be another big success.</p>
<p><span style="text-align:center; display: block;"><a href="http://photographyandpolitics.wordpress.com/2008/11/11/a-21st-century-candidate/"><img src="http://img.youtube.com/vi/0xJCaw3Pmf0/2.jpg" alt="" /></a></span></p>
<p>But it&#8217;s not just the use of technology that made Obama a modern candidate, there&#8217;s something about him that appealed to a new generation of voters.  Whether that was his age, or something else i&#8217;m not sure, but Obama certainly connected with this new generation in so many ways that McCain could never have hoped to.  This is clear just from Obama&#8217;s coverage in places like Rolling Stone magazine.  Obama has been on the cover of Rolling Stone three times in seven months, this is unprecedented, not just for a politician but for a musician.  Only John Lennon had the same number of covers in the same period.</p>
<p>The only question that remains is whether Obama can now be a modern President.</p>

<p>Youth voter participation is extremely low around the world, and mobilising the youth vote can sometimes be virtually impossible.  The last general election in the UK saw roughly 40% of eligible voters under 25 actually get to the polling station.  In some parts of the country that figure is much lower!  So i&#8217;m glad to see efforts like this video to encourage young Americans to register to vote.  I&#8217;d like to see similar things at the next UK election.</p>
